The Evolution of a Goal Machine

To understand the total goals messi and ronaldo have accumulated, one must first appreciate the context of their development. Ronaldo began his career as a mercurial winger, celebrated for his explosive pace and aerial ability. His goal tally at Sporting CP and Manchester United hinted at his predatory instincts, but it was his transformation at Real Madrid that unlocked his full scoring potential. Embraced as a central striker, he honed his finishing, physicality, and positioning, becoming the benchmark for the modern goal-scoring winger turned number nine. His total goals reflect a journey of adaptation and self-reinvention, maximizing his athleticism for maximum output in the box.

Positional Impact on Scoring

Cristiano Ronaldo has frequently played as a central striker or target man, positioning himself in prime scoring areas.

Lionel Messi has thrived as a forward playmaker, cutting inside from the flank or dropping deep to create and score.

Ronaldo's role often requires him to be the focal point of the attack, demanding constant service in the box.

Messi's freedom to roam allows him to find pockets of space, turning half-chances into goals with minimal effort.
